But a new car and the question always arises if you follow the forums
Should I keep it or swap it for something else that's more reliable?
My experience is that whatever car you own it has generally has major issues according to some of the owner forums
Saab 95 3 litre Diesel engine issues mine did over 176k miles and no problems and according to mid website is still on the road after over 15 years

Merc c class 250d - major issues with injectors failing, but after 92k miles when I changed it it had been totally reliable with no issues apart from one rear light bulb and new wiper blades and was still going when I recently saw it locally.
Freelander 2 diesel manual - major issues with gearbox - no problems with mine after 3.5 years, before trading in for current disco4.
Current disco 4 landmark is a fantastic car, but note the concerns on the forum about engine failures, however given the numbers of fantastic condition older D2, D3, and D4 on the road and going strong. Should I be concerned?
Looked at a Jeep but depreciation is horrible, reckon lower depreciation on the disco would cover the cost of a new engine if needed!
It's a pity there isn't a "how wonderful my car" thread on the forums to help counteract the negative issues - although LR and other manufacturers could and should be a lot more proactive in this area to reduce doubts and assure owners about long term reliability and assist owners - this proactive approach would be far more productive and cost effective than the massive advertising campaigns they indulge in.

Intend to keep mine for a good few years as so far, it's been an absolutely fantastic car, although some of the technology may be a little old hat it should by now be well proven. Fingers crossed it stays reliable.

From looking at previous threads, I think this chap was a bit sensitive anyway, so I wouldn't read too much into it. However, some other owners are having some real issues and the dealers seem to be incapable of solving them and their service / support levels seem woeful. Its not great for the LR brand as a premium marque.

It'll be interesting to see how the residuals of these early cars fair. I'm not sure if the vehicle truly reflects the price tag; £70k+ is a lot of money for a generic looking SUV, even if it carries a LR badge and has the off-road capability it claims. Particularly when its given away some of the unique selling points it had over other cars, the practicality element being just one. Anyway, time will tell. I hope they get it right with the Defender, but LR's launch record isn't great.
